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Geneva Water Fountains (Jet d’Eau) , one of the most iconic attractions in the city. Afterward, visit the Palais des Nations , the European headquarters of the United Nations, for a guided tour.
Afternoon
Explore the charming Geneva Old Town (Vieille Ville) , which features narrow cobblestone streets, historic buildings, and charming cafes. Stop by the Flower Clock (Horloge Fleurie) , a beautiful timepiece adorned with over 6,500 flowers, before visiting St. Peter's Cathedral (Cathédrale St-Pierre) , a stunning Gothic church that dates back to the 12th century.
Evening
End your night at Tavel House (Maison Tavel) , a museum that showcases the history and culture of Geneva's Old Town.

Morning
Take a train to Zermatt, a picturesque mountain town that is known for its stunning views of the Matterhorn. Once you arrive, take a ride on the Gornergrat Railway (Gornergrat Bahn) , which off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ains and glaciers.
Afternoon
Visit the Zermatt-Matterhorn Ski Paradise , one of the largest ski resorts in the world, for some skiing or snowboarding. Afterward, take a cable car to Sunnegga , a popular hiking and skiing destination that offers stunning views of the Matterhorn.
Evening
End your night with a visit to Matterhorn Glacier Paradise , Europe's highest cable car station, which offers breathtaking views of the Matterhorn and the surrounding glaciers.

Morning
Take a train to Grindelwald, a charming mountain village that is known for its stunning views of the Eiger. Explore the village and stop by Pfingstegg , a popular hiking and paragliding destination that off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ains.
Afternoon
Take a cable car to Jungfrau , one of the highest peaks in the Swiss Alps, for stunning views of the surrounding mountains and glaciers. Afterward, visit the Glacier Canyon , a natural wonder that features towering ice formations and turquoise blue water.
Evening
End your night with dinner at a local restaurant that offers traditional Swiss cuisine, such as fondue or raclette.

Morning
Take a train to Lucerne, a beautiful city that is known for its historic architecture and stunning scenery. Visit the Chapel Bridge (Kapellbrucke) , a covered wooden bridge that dates back to the 14th century and is one of the most iconic landmarks in Switzerland.
Afternoon
Explore Lucerne Old Town , which features a variety of historic buildings, charming cafes, and boutique shops. Stop by the Lion Monument (Löwendenkmal) , a sculpture that commemorates the Swiss Guards who were killed during the French Revolution.
Evening
End your night at the Culture and Congress Centre (KKL) , a modern building that features a variety of cultural events and performances.

Morning
Take a train to Zurich, the largest city in Switzerland and a hub of culture and commerce. Visit the Swiss Museum of Transport (Verkehrshaus der Schweiz) , which features a variety of exhibits and interactive displays that showcase the history of transportation in Switzerland.
Afternoon
Explore Zurich Old Town, which features a variety of historic buildings, charming cafes, and boutique shops. Stop by the Fraumünster Church, which features stunning stained glass windows designed by Marc Chagall.
Evening
End your night at the Rosengart Collection (Museum Sammlung Rosengart) , a museum that features a variety of works by famous artists such as Pablo Picasso and Paul Klee.

Morning
Take a train back to Geneva and visit the International Red Cross and Red Crescent Museum , which showcases the history and impact of these organizations on humanitarian efforts around the world.
Afternoon
Visit the Brunswick Monument , a neoclassical monument that was built to commemorate the life of Charles II, Duke of Brunswick. Afterward, visit the International Museum of the Reformation (Musée International de la Réforme) , which features a variety of exhibits and interactive displays that showcase the impact of the Reformation on European history.
Evening
End your night with a visit to the Patek Philippe Museum , which features a variety of exhibits and displays that showcase the history and craftsmanship of Swiss watchmaking.
